The Bucs shuffled the deck to their roster out of some necessities to due to injuries. Starting with the 53-man roster, the Bucs waived rookie undrafted corner Keenan Isaac while elevating veteran wide receiver David Moore to fill his spot.
The Tampa Bay Buccaneers have won two straight games and are back in control of their own destiny ahead of the final stretch of the regular season. The team is doing some housekeeping to shore up its 53-man roster and practice squad prior to traveling to Green Bay.
The Tampa Bay Buccaneers signing rookie long-snapper Evan Deckers to their practice squad. As reported by Fox Sports’ Greg Auman, Deckers was signed due to an elbow injury to current long-snapper Zach Triner.
